Hainan’s Jan-Apr. trade valued at 59.84 billion RMB

"In the first four months of this year, Hainan's international trade maintained good momentum and achieved satisfactory results. Hainan’s international trade continued to lead the country in terms of growth, and hit a new high in April." In a press conference on May 20, Tian Tao, Deputy Commissioner Director of Haikou Customs District P.R.China, said that Hainan has made strong achievements in international trade in the first four months of 2022, showing that the free trade port is continuing to develop strongly.

According to Haikou Customs, in the first four months of 2022, Hainan’s trade in goods imports and exports were valued at 59.84 billion RMB (almost 8.95 billion USD), an increase of 68.8% over the same period last year. That’s 60.9 percentage points faster than the rest of the country, the fastest rate of increase in China. 
 
Imports reached 44.66 billion RMB (almost 6.68 billion USD), up 62.8%, increasing faster than the national average of 57.7 percentage points, and again ranking first in China. The total value of exports reached 15.18 billion RMB (almost 2.27 billion USD), up 89.6%, increasing 79.3 percentage points faster than the rest of the country and ranking second in China.
 
In April, Hainan's trade in goods imports and exports measured 16.47 billion RMB (almost 2.46 billion USD), increasing by 80.2%, the highest value of the previous five months. Exports accounted for 4.96 billion RMB (almost 0.74 billion USD), the highest value since January 2021, increasing by 137.4%, while imports totaled 11.51 billion yuan, an increase of 63.2%.
